PHP 社区

From binaryoption
Revision as of 00:25, 9 May 2025 by Admin (talk | contribs) (@pipegas_WP)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Баннер1
  1. PHP 社区

PHP 社区是一个庞大、活跃且多样化的群体,它支持和推动着 PHP 编程语言的发展。对于初学者来说,理解并参与到这个社区中至关重要,因为它能极大地加速学习过程,并提供解决问题、分享知识和建立人脉的机会。 本文将深入探讨 PHP 社区的各个方面,包括其历史、组织结构、主要参与者、获取支持的途径以及如何贡献社区。由于我同时也是二元期权领域的专家,我会尝试将一些社区协作的理念与二元期权交易中风险管理和策略分享的相似之处进行对比(仅作为类比,切勿将编程社区与金融交易混淆)。

PHP 社区的历史和演变

PHP 最初由 Rasmus Lerdorf 于 1994 年创建,最初只是为了维护他的个人简历页面。随着时间的推移,它逐渐发展成为一种广泛使用的服务器端脚本语言。 PHP 社区的发展与 PHP 语言本身的演变紧密相连。早期,社区主要由少量开发者组成,他们通过邮件列表和 IRC 频道进行交流。随着 PHP 的流行,社区规模不断扩大,涌现出越来越多的开发者、用户和贡献者。

PHP 5 的发布,特别是面向对象编程 (OOP) 的引入,是社区发展的一个重要里程碑。这吸引了更多企业级开发者加入,并推动了 PHP 在大型项目中的应用。 随着 PHP 7 及更高版本的发布,性能得到了显著提升,这进一步巩固了 PHP 在 Web 开发领域的主导地位。

就像任何复杂的系统一样,PHP社区也经历过分化和融合。例如,曾经出现过“PHP 6”的计划,但最终被取消,社区围绕 PHP 7 的开发方向达成共识。这种共识机制是社区健康发展的保证。

PHP 社区的组织结构

PHP 社区并非由单一机构控制,而是由多个组织和个人共同维护和推动。

  • PHP Group:PHP Group 是 PHP 的官方组织,负责维护 PHP 源代码、发布新版本、制定语言规范等核心工作。
  • The PHP Foundation:致力于为PHP的长期发展提供资金和资源支持。它是一个非盈利组织,通过接受捐赠和赞助来维持运营。
  • PHP-FIG:PHP Framework Interop Group (PHP-FIG) 是一个由框架开发者组成的组织,旨在推广 PHP 框架之间的互操作性,制定通用的编码标准和接口。这有助于开发者更容易地在不同的框架之间切换和集成。
  • 地方用户组 (PUG):世界各地都有许多 PHP 用户组,它们定期组织聚会、研讨会和技术交流活动。
  • 开源项目贡献者:大量的开发者通过贡献代码、文档、测试用例等方式参与到 PHP 生态系统的建设中。

与二元期权交易中的专业交易员组成社群分享经验类似,PHP社区的组织结构并非层级分明,而是更加扁平化和协作化。每个人都可以根据自己的能力和兴趣参与到社区的建设中。

主要的参与者

PHP 社区汇集了各种各样的参与者,包括:

获取支持的途径

PHP 社区提供了多种获取支持的途径:

  • 官方文档:PHP 的官方文档是学习 PHP 的最佳起点。它包含了 PHP 语言的各个方面的详细说明。
  • Stack Overflow:Stack Overflow 是一个流行的编程问答网站,你可以在这里找到大量的 PHP 相关问题和答案。
  • PHP 邮件列表:PHP 邮件列表是与 PHP 开发者交流的有效途径。
  • IRC 频道:PHP 社区维护着多个 IRC 频道,你可以在这里实时地与其他开发者进行交流。
  • 论坛:一些网站和社区维护着 PHP 相关的论坛,你可以在这里提问和分享经验。
  • 社交媒体:可以通过 TwitterFacebook 等社交媒体平台关注 PHP 相关的账号和群组,获取最新的信息和动态。
  • 本地用户组 (PUG):参加本地用户组的聚会,与其他 PHP 开发者面对面交流。

类似于二元期权交易者学习技术分析和风险管理,PHP初学者可以利用这些资源学习PHP的核心概念和最佳实践。

如何贡献社区

参与到 PHP 社区的建设中,不仅可以帮助他人,还可以提升自己的技能和影响力。以下是一些贡献社区的方式:

  • 报告错误:如果你在使用 PHP 时发现了错误,请及时报告给 PHP 官方团队。
  • 提交补丁:如果你有能力修复错误或改进 PHP 的代码,可以提交补丁。
  • 编写文档:你可以帮助完善 PHP 的官方文档,或者编写教程和博客文章。
  • 翻译文档:将 PHP 的官方文档翻译成其他语言,让更多的人能够学习 PHP。
  • 参与讨论:在邮件列表、IRC 频道和论坛上参与讨论,分享你的经验和知识。
  • 开发库和组件:开发有用的 PHP 库和组件,分享给其他开发者。
  • 组织活动:组织本地用户组的聚会、研讨会和技术交流活动。
  • 测试新版本:测试 PHP 的新版本,并提供反馈。

正如二元期权交易者分享交易策略和风险管理经验一样,PHP开发者通过贡献代码、文档和知识,共同推动着PHP生态系统的发展。

PHP 社区与二元期权交易的相似之处 (类比)

虽然 PHP 开发与二元期权交易是完全不同的领域,但它们在社区协作和知识共享方面存在一些有趣的相似之处:

  • **信息共享:** 两个领域都依赖于信息的快速传播和共享。在PHP社区,开发者分享代码、经验和最佳实践。在二元期权交易中,交易者分享市场分析、交易策略和风险管理技巧。
  • **风险管理:** 在PHP开发中,代码质量、安全性和可维护性是重要的风险管理因素。在二元期权交易中,资金管理、风险评估和止损策略是至关重要的。
  • **持续学习:** 两个领域都需要持续学习和适应新的技术和市场变化。
  • **反馈机制:** 两个领域都依赖于反馈机制来改进和完善。在PHP社区,开发者通过代码审查和用户反馈来改进代码质量。在二元期权交易中,交易者通过交易记录和市场分析来改进交易策略。
  • **社区支持:** 两个领域都受益于强大的社区支持。

需要强调的是,这种类比仅用于说明社区协作的重要性,切勿将编程社区与金融交易混淆。

重要的 PHP 资源链接

相关策略、技术分析和成交量分析 (仅作类比,与 PHP 无直接关系)

总结

PHP 社区是一个充满活力和机遇的群体。 通过积极参与到社区中,你可以学习到新的知识、提升自己的技能、建立人脉并为 PHP 生态系统的发展做出贡献。 无论你是 PHP 初学者还是经验丰富的开发者,都应该充分利用社区提供的资源和支持。记住,社区的力量是无穷的!

立即开始交易

注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)

加入我们的社区

订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源

Баннер